To be considered for this role, you must have an NVQ2 in Pharmacy Services or an accredited equivalent course, as well as a Medicine Counter Assistant (MCA) qualification.
Additionally, we are looking for candidates with experience working in a customer-focused environment, a strong understanding of confidentiality, and the ability to handle medications accurately.

Job Summary
To be responsible for theprocessing of prescriptions in accordance with practice policy and extantlegislation. In addition, the post holder will be required to support the DispensaryManager in ensuring a high-level of service is delivered at all times whilstsupporting the multi-disciplinary team in line with the strategic objectives ofthe practice.
Thefollowing are the core responsibilities of the Dispenser. There may be, onoccasion, a requirement to carry out other tasks; this will be dependent uponfactors such as workload and staffing levels:
a. To be responsible for checking allmedicines dispensed, ensuring there are no discrepancies
b. Dispensing medicines to the entitledpopulation safely and accurately
c. Collecting prescription charges inaccordance with dispensary protocol
d. Maintaining stock levels within thedispensary, liaising with the dispensary manager to facilitate reordering
e. Receiving and storing supplies inaccordance with current policy, ensuring the cold chain is maintained whereapplicable
f. Ensuring controlled drugs are dispensedin accordance with practice policy
g. Ensuring safe disposal of returnedand/or out of date medicines
h. Ensuring all repeat prescriptions areprocessed within a 48-hour timeframe
i.Providing patients with advice regardingall prescription matters
j.Processing prescription requests viaemail, phone, fax, face-to-face and online
l. Assisting the Dispensary Manager in thepreparation of monthly returns
m. Always maintaining a clean and safeworking environment
n. Always maintain accurate records, includingappropriate coding entries
